确定磁带备份时使用的block size

上一篇 / 下一篇  2008-01-06 16:35:33 / 个人分类:AIX

从磁带中恢复数据时,如果恢复时设置的磁带的block size与备份时设置的值不同,恢复时就会报错。

有两种方法可以确认磁带的block size:

(1) 用tcopy命令

# tcopy /dev/rmt0
tcopy : Tape File: 1; Records: 1 to 7179 ;size:512
tcopy : Tape File: 1; End of file after :7179 records; 3675648 bytes
tcopy : Tape File: 2; Records: 1 to 2900 ;size:512
tcopy : Tape File: 2; End of file after 2900 records, 76890 bytes

 其中的size:512 表示block size为512

(2) 使用dd命令读取一个块

dd if=/dev/rmt0 bs=128k count=1 | wc -c

返回值即为block size

改变磁带block size设置:

# chdev -l rmt0 -a block_size=512


TAG:

杂记铺 引用 删除 fjmingyang   /   2008-01-07 11:47:57
第二个方法较为实用
 

评分:0

我来说两句

显示全部

:loveliness: :handshake :victory: :funk: :time: :kiss: :call: :hug: :lol :'( :Q :L ;P :$ :P :o :@ :D :( :)

日历

« 2009-01-09  
    123
45678910
11121314151617
18192021222324
25262728293031

数据统计

  • 访问量: 3575
  • 日志数: 68
  • 建立时间: 2007-12-19
  • 更新时间: 2009-01-09

RSS订阅

Open Toolbar